Transaction edc0f176a8d310b83a9986f18a8832cbcbfd8fa657b598d1a115043b2d6902e7

1 Input
2 Outputs
  • edc0f176a8d310b83a9986f18a8832cbcbfd8fa657b598d1a115043b2d6902e7:0
  • value  26836387
    address  1Ph2e7oTLsyBAPfGHLzSAuFQzn2TAghHN1
  • edc0f176a8d310b83a9986f18a8832cbcbfd8fa657b598d1a115043b2d6902e7:1
  • value  5900000
    address  1JeRWn3qpaMBdrbvNAWfuZRCUyAXvjh7jv